Criminal Justice Graduate Assistant

Job DescriptionJob Summary:The CU Division of Social Science is seeking a graduate assistant to serve as a teaching assistant and research assistant to faculty in the Division, especially faculty in the Department of Criminal Justice. The candidate should have coursework and/or experience in social science research methods and must be a full-time student in good standing in a CU graduate program. Students in the MS Criminal Justice program will be given preference.Job Responsibilities:The successful candidate will assist faculty in the Division in their teaching and research endeavors. As needed, the candidate will:• Assist faculty in setting up, tearing down, and managing classroom activities• Proctor exams• Assist faculty in instructing and managing remote and hybrid classes• Tutor undergraduate students• Assist in the criminal justice honor society as a graduate mentor• Assist faculty in collecting and managing data• Contribute to the management of research projects being conducted by faculty• Serve as a student supervisor on field trips and other engaged learning activitiesSkills/Qualifications:Must be a full-time graduate student in good standing at CU.Bachelor's degree with a major or minor in a social science.Coursework and/or experience in social science research and statistics.
